Working principle: when work, staff can be used operation button 6 and display screen 4 cooperated to assign work order, and can
To be used cooperatively the agent that can be very good allotment textile auxiliary by storage room 9 graduated cylinder 2, rubber head dropper 3 and measuring cup 10
It is then put into uniformizing bin 19 by commissioning pipe 16, and makes its sealing using sealing cover 17 by amount, and motor 14 works at this time
And passes through upper paddle 22 and lower paddle 24 on agitating shaft 13 and auxiliary rod 23 is cooperated adequately to stir textile auxiliary
Mixing works with post-heater 8 and is heated by heating tube 12 to textile auxiliary, so that it be made adequately to mix, is conducive to
Equipment carries out efficient homocline processing to textile auxiliary, can finally open valve 21 for the textile auxiliary after homocline and pass through discharging
Pipe 20 is discharged.
